轻松指南:如何将Windows文件迁移至虚拟机内
怎么把Windows的文件移到虚拟机

首页 2025-02-21 12:58:16



Windows文件迁移至虚拟机的全面指南 在数字化时代,虚拟机(Virtual Machine)已成为软件开发、测试、学习等多种场景下的必备工具

    虚拟机允许用户在同一物理计算机上运行多个操作系统,极大地提高了工作效率和资源利用率

    然而,如何在Windows操作系统与虚拟机之间高效、安全地传输文件,成为了许多用户面临的实际问题

    本文将详细介绍几种将Windows文件移至虚拟机的方法,旨在帮助用户根据自身需求选择最适合的方案

     一、共享文件夹:局域网内的便捷传输 对于运行在同一局域网内的Windows主机和虚拟机,共享文件夹无疑是一种简单而高效的传输方式

    以下是具体步骤: 1.设置共享文件夹: - 在Windows主机上,找到希望共享的磁盘或文件夹,右键点击并选择“属性”

     - 进入“共享”选项卡,点击“高级共享”按钮

     - 勾选“共享此文件夹”选项,并根据需要设置共享名称和权限

     2.获取Windows主机的IP地址: - 打开Windows命令提示符(按Win+R,输入cmd后回车),输入`ipconfig`命令,查看并记录IPv4地址

     3.在虚拟机中访问共享文件夹: - 打开虚拟机软件(如VMware、VirtualBox等),确保虚拟机处于运行状态

     - 在虚拟机内部,打开文件管理器,使用网络位置访问共享文件夹

    通常格式为`【Windows主机IPv4地址】共享文件夹名称`

     - 输入Windows主机的用户名和密码(如果需要),即可访问并传输文件

     这种方法的优势在于设置简单,传输速度快,特别适合于大量文件的传输

    但需要注意的是,共享文件夹的访问权限应合理设置,以防数据泄露

     二、映射网络驱动器:虚拟机软件自带的高效功能 虚拟机软件通常提供了映射网络驱动器的功能,这一功能在虚拟机关闭状态下进行配置,可以视为磁盘间的直接文件传输,速度较快

    以下是操作步骤: 1.关闭虚拟机:确保虚拟机处于关闭状态

     2.配置映射网络驱动器: - 在虚拟机软件中,找到虚拟机的设置选项

     - 选择“存储”或类似选项,添加一个新的网络驱动器映射

     - 设置映射的驱动器字母、路径(指向Windows主机的共享文件夹)及访问权限

     3.启动虚拟机:开启虚拟机后,即可在虚拟机内部看到映射的网络驱动器,像操作本地磁盘一样进行文件传输

     需要注意的是,不同版本的虚拟机软件在界面和功能上可能有所差异,用户需参考具体软件的文档进行操作

    此外,映射网络驱动器在虚拟机17版本之后可能被取消,此时可考虑使用其他方法

     三、利用磁盘管理工具:DiskGenius等工具的应用 对于不熟悉虚拟机内部设置的用户,DiskGenius等磁盘管理工具提供了更为直观的传输方式

    以下是操作步骤: 1.下载并安装DiskGenius:在Windows主机上下载并安装DiskGenius软件

     2.打开虚拟机磁盘文件: - 在DiskGenius中,点击“磁盘”菜单,选择“打开虚拟磁盘文件”

     - 浏览并选择虚拟机软件生成的虚拟磁盘文件(如.vmdk、.vdi等)

     3.传输文件: - 将需要传输的文件拖放到DiskGenius打开的虚拟磁盘窗口中

     - 保存并关闭DiskGenius,重新启动虚拟机以查看传输的文件

     这种方法适合不熟悉命令行操作的用户,操作相对简单直观

    但需要注意的是,使用第三方磁盘管理工具时应确保软件来源可靠,以防病毒或恶意软件的感染

     四、安装VMWare Tools:复制粘贴的轻松实现 对于VMware用户而言,安装VMWare Tools是实现文件轻松传输的最佳选择

    以下是操作步骤: 1.安装VMWare Tools: - 在虚拟机运行状态下,点击上方菜单中的“虚拟机”选项

     - 选择“安装VMware Tools”,按照提示完成安装

     2.使用复制粘贴功能: - 安装成功后,即可在Windows主机和虚拟机之间直接复制粘贴文件

     - 若发现无法直接拖动文件,可稍等片刻,待光标发生变化后再松开鼠标

     VMWare Tools不仅提供了文件传输功能,还优化了虚拟机的图形显示、鼠标指针同步等方面,是VMware用户不可或缺的工具

     五、Xshell/XFTP:远程传输的专业选择 对于需要通过远程连接进行文件传输的用户,Xshell/XFTP组合提供了强大的解决方案

    以下是操作步骤: 1.获取虚拟机IP地址:在虚拟机内部,使用`ifconfig`命令获取网卡信息,包括IP地址

     2.连接虚拟机: - 使用Xshell软件连接到虚拟机,输入虚拟机的IP地址、用户名和密码

     - 连接成功后,点击Xshell上方的XFTP标志,启动XFTP进行文件传输

     3.传输文件: - 在XFTP界面中,可以像操作本地文件夹一样拖动或双击文件进行传输

     Xshell/XFTP组合适用于需要频繁进行远程文件传输的用户,特别是开发人员和系统管理员

    但需要注意的是,使用前应确保虚拟机已开启SSH服务,并配置好相应的访问权限

     六、总结与建议 将Windows文件移至虚拟机的方法多种多样,每种方法都有其独特的优势和适用场景

    用户应根据自身需求、技术水平以及虚拟机软件的具体版本选择合适的传输方式

    以下是几点总结与建议: - 共享文件夹和映射网络驱动器适合大量文件的快速传输,但需注意访问权限的设置

     - DiskGenius等磁盘管理工具适合不熟悉虚拟机内部设置的用户,操作相对简单直观

     - VMWare Tools是VMware用户的首选方案,提供了全面的功能优化

     - Xshell/XFTP组合适用于远程文件传输场景,特别是开发人员和系统管理员

     无论选择哪种方法,都应确保数据传输的安全性,避免数据泄露或丢失

    同时,定期备份虚拟机文件也是保障数据安全的重要措施

    希望本文能帮助用户高效、安全地将Windows文件移至虚拟机,提升工作效率和体验

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道